Transaction 34ab2810871b1607e712692e2b50c00a2790669d819025b3f5ecac582363e608
1 Input
1 Output
-
34ab2810871b1607e712692e2b50c00a2790669d819025b3f5ecac582363e608:0
- value
- 102006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 13ee3ca8ccb158a48a761676a8e5e523ce0a8d1a OP_EQUAL
- address
- 33WQABWhRAeKroLrgDv84CNM2f2UgdQgPH